Eben........That Flaptail { Bernie Calitri } is the correct bait for the box.......Also that Pt. Jude { Surf Slapper } is the correct bait for the box, "Very Nice Combo".........Calitri was a well known striped bass fishermen in the 1940's, as was Jerry Sylvester, Ray Tucker, etc....as far as I know Bernie endorsed Striper-Experts { early Pt. Jude } and Pt. Jude Lures as a field tester. Don't take this as gospel... But, I also believe he may have worked for Pt. Jude manufacturing and painting lures. He then left at some point and then started Cal-Kay................

Eben, hate to say it but it could be either a Pt. Jude or an Emmerson & Ruhren.... I don't remember if anyone I know has one in the correct box, I'll have to ask around.....we need to find a few in boxes I guess to be certain.....
The Facts:
1] the wire in the front is tied just like a Pt. Jude, not a Ruhren
2] the flaptail is attached like some Pt. Jude baits
3] the body looks like a Ruhren
4] the paint job looks like Pt. Jude [ later model colors ], or Emmerson & Ruhren, or even SO-CO...... they all had very similar paint jobs.
Well, whatever that bait is........ it sure is nice........ the other Calitri bait and box are correct.......Good Luck & Thanks For Showing Them
